Jesse works with CNOY.org 

Late in 2022 Jesse was approached by CNOY's woodstock branch to write and record a song to help promote their annual fundraiser on February 25, 2023. Details can be found at www.cnoy.org

It was an honour and a pleasure to work with CNOY to produce this song and video. Please consider volunteering or making a donation.
